Domino 服务器定时重启

Domino 服务器定时重启linux

做为一个企业管理员来讲,保证服务的正常运行是必不可少的技能,咱们都知道Windows系统长期不重启会有不少资源被占用,长期不重启会致使程序运行缓慢,因此须要定时重启;一样对应的服务也须要定时重启,windows的操做相比linux简单不少,毕竟windows是图形操做的,操做比较明了简单。说到应用,通常Domino服务安装在windows下也是比较多的,像咱们企业也是安装到windows下的, 安装到linux想运行相比比windows稳定一点,因此后期咱们也会考虑将服务安装到linux下,今天主要说说如何定时重启Domino服务。数据库

Domino重启的方式有不少种。好比经过agent定时重启服务,或者经过domino的配置来完成domino的定时重启,今天咱们针对这两种来介绍一下。windows

1.经过配置来按期重启安全

咱们经过note管理端打开names.nsf----->configuration---->servers----->programbash

p_w_picpath

add program服务器

p_w_picpath

咱们填写基本信息session

program name :nserverdom

command line:-c “restart server”ide

server to run: 选择对应须要重启的服务器代理

schedule:咱们选择定时重启的日期时间及方式

p_w_picpath

而后保存退出

p_w_picpath

咱们用administrator打开对应的服务器----->服务器----->日程安排----程序

p_w_picpath

p_w_picpath

咱们等待13:50查看状态

咱们看见服务器的console有重启的记录及状态了

p_w_picpath

第二种方法就是咱们用代理

咱们使用代理的话,须要在服务器上建立一个数据库,而后新建代理

新建一个数据库名:restartserver

p_w_picpath

在代码处理---新建代理

p_w_picpath

定义代理名称

p_w_picpath

定义代理

%REM
	Agent rstserver
	Created 2017-10-7 by Administrator/ixmsoft
	Description: Comments for Agent
%END REM
Option Public
Option Declare


Sub initialize
    Dim session As New NotesSession
	Dim cdb As NotesDatabase
	Dim commandstr As String
	Dim result As String
	
	Set cdb =session.currentdatabase
	
	commandstr="restart server"
	
	result = session.sendconsolecommand(cdb.server,commandstr)
	
End Sub

p_w_picpath

咱们定义代理的运行时间----定时运行---天天屡次----日程安排----5分钟执行一次

p_w_picpath

安全性

p_w_picpath

咱们发现代理已经执行了

p_w_picpath